About the position Heitman is seeking an experienced Asset Manager to join our team. The ideal candidate will bring their subject matter expertise within the Medical and Commercial property sectors to our North American private equity team to proactively manage these assets within our clients’ portfolios. This role will be highly collaborative, and the successful candidate will be expected to build effective relationships with both internal teams within Heitman (including Portfolio Management, Acquisitions, Financing, and Financial Operations & Analysis), as well as effectively partner with external stakeholders including leasing and property management agents, venture partners, and clients.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to: Manage a multi-property real estate portfolio focused on Medical Office Buildings and Commercial assets. Devise and implement asset management strategies, including income and expense maximization, leasing, capital expenditures, financing/refinancing, hold/sell, and value creation, applying both qualitative and quantitative analysis. Monitor market conditions at both a macro and micro level to proactively direct the successful performance of the investments. Oversee the preparation of annual budgets, business plans, internal valuations, and quarterly reporting. Evaluate investment performance against budgets, business plans, and internal and external benchmarks. Work closely with Heitman’s Data Analytics and Financial Operations and Analysis teams to inform asset level strategy and drive performance. Partner with and oversee third parties performing the day-to-day operations of the assets. Conduct regular property inspections to identify property risks and opportunities, evaluate operational performance of third-party teams, and understand market dynamics; communicate findings. Communicate recommendations and results both orally and in writing to clients, Heitman’s Investment Committee, portfolio managers, Asset Management leaders, and sector specialists. Support Heitman’s Acquisitions and Research teams for new investment underwriting and diligence, providing market and leasing input and participating in due diligence activities, as necessary. Ensure compliance with a variety of legal documents, including joint venture agreements, loan agreements, and investment management agreements. Coordinate as necessary the hiring of third-party agents, such as appraisers, brokers, property managers, leasing agents, and legal counsel.

Requirements

  • Minimum 7 years of real estate experience with at least 3 years of real estate asset management experience.
  • Experience with either Medical Office Buildings or Commercial property types is required.
  • Strong interpersonal skills with an ability to collaborate with others.
  • Ability to communicate complex issues clearly and professionally, both verbally and in writing.
  • Strong analytical skills and experience with cash flow modeling and analysis, budgeting, financial reporting, and interpreting data.
  • Creative problem-solving skills for defining, developing, and executing asset management strategies.
  • Understanding of standard real estate practices and investment trends.
  • Knowledge of construction and redevelopment terminology for overseeing the budgeting and planning of capital projects.
  • Working knowledge of legal terminology for interpreting and negotiating a variety of real estate agreements.
  • Ability and desire to utilize industry expertise and leadership skills to mentor junior team members.
  • Understanding of the various real estate valuation approaches and techniques.
  • Strong financial modeling skills (ARGUS, Microsoft Excel); experience with Power BI is a plus.
